31,500,842 is a composite number, even.
31,500,842 (thirty-one million five hundred thousand eight hundred forty-two) is an even 8-digit number. It is a composite number with 8 divisors, and factors as 2 × 809 × 19,469. Written other ways, in hexadecimal, 0x1E0AA2A.
